AI summary

GP Petroleums has signed a 50:50 joint venture agreement with Vadodara-based West Coast Oils LLP to manufacture and trade specialty bitumen products, including Bitumen Emulsions, Polymer Modified Bitumen (PMB), and Crumb Rubber Modified Bitumen (CRMB). Both parties will contribute equally to the JV company's equity, share equal board representation, and may also extend unsecured loans at 12% per annum interest. The newly-formed JV company will acquire a bitumen plant from New Horizons Asphalt Private Limited, which is a related party of GP Petroleums (this related-party transaction was approved by the Audit Committee and Board on October 10, 2024). The move is aimed at expanding the company's footprint in the specialty bitumen segment and capitalising on India's infrastructure growth. This is a domestic joint venture, and the investment is not classified as a related-party transaction for GPPL.

Likely market impact

This JV could strengthen GP Petroleums' position in the higher-margin specialty bitumen space, riding on government infrastructure spending. However, with a 50:50 split, profits and risks are shared equally, and the actual investment size remains undisclosed at this stage.
